RIC 726 Domitian
|
AR Denarius, 3.72g
Rome mint, 91 AD
Obv: IMP CAES DOMIT AVG GERM P M TR P XI; Head of Domitian, laureate, bearded, r.
Rev: IMP XXI COS XV CENS P P P; Minerva stg. l., with thunderbolt and spear; shield at her l. side (M3)
RIC 726 (C). BMC 184. RSC 268. BNC -.
Acquired from Praefectus Coins, February 2014.
Struck between 14 September and 31 December 91, this is a fairly common denarius. I had some attribution difficulty due to the partially off flan COS date, which differenates this issue from the more common following issue. Once in hand with a good loupe I was able to see it was indeed COS XV.
What stands out to me about this coin is the very high style portrait (very different than my RIC 724 from the same issue). Exceptionally well engraved in good metal with a nice large flan.
